Craig Hearn

Europe Internationals (2023-04-14)
Placement1182/1525Record2/5
Prev. ELO1000New ELO889 (-111)
Prev. Rank-New Rank#6561 (+6561)
Europe Internationals (2023-04-14)
Placement1182/1525Record2/5
Prev. ELO1000New ELO889 (-111)
Prev. Rank-New Rank#6561 (+6561)